Preparing Children for Reading Success: Hands-On Activities for Librarians, Educators, and Caregivers will not only familiarize anyone who reads to young children with the essentials of promoting early and emerging literacy, but also contains more than 25 ready-to-go activities that can be immediately used to foster this critical skill development.

Following a basic overview of preliteracy skills that prepare children for reading success, the book contains field-tested, proven activities that promote success in each of the following skill sets:·Alphabet knowledge·Print concepts·Book handling skills·Phonological sensitivity·Expressive vocabularyEach of the activities is described in detail and linked to a popular children’s book.
